Application conditions: 1. Choose a visa center, choose the corresponding British consulate according to the province where my account is located, choose the nearest visa center within the jurisdiction, and conduct self-inspection before issuing a visa.

2. Check whether the required materials are complete, including: three application forms, passport, CASStatement, materials listed on CAS, proof of funds, other supporting materials and visa fees.

3. All submitted originals must have a copy. If it is a Chinese original, another translation is needed. Need a visa photo, the requirement is a recent photo within 6 months.

4. Line up at the visa center. The first thing to do when entering the visa center is to get the number. Visa centers generally have numbering machines, and student study visas belong to other types of visas. Observe the terrain and find the path. In the process of waiting, find out where the visa materials are reviewed, where the payment window is, and where the fingerprints are pressed, so that when it's your turn, you will be calm and unhurried.

5. Collect fingerprints and hand in materials. Only one person is allowed to enter the fingerprint area at a time, with a material bag, free of charge; Need to take digital photos, take ten fingerprints, first four fingers in the right hand, then four fingers in the left hand, and the last two thumbs; When the material package is handed in here, just take out the receipt of the fingerprint and the signature will be over.
